msg149789 - (view) Author: Meador Inge (meador.inge) * (Python committer) Date: 2011年12月18日 18:20
When making the changes to remove backticks in eb2f70fdbf32, the _PyParser_TokenNames table was incorrectly updated. Now the indexes into _PyParser_TokenNames don't match the token numbers. This can be seen in the output of 'python -d':
 $ echo '2 << 1' | ./python -d | grep Token
 ...
 Token NUMBER/'2' ... It's a token we know
 Token RIGHTSHIFT/'<<' ... It's a token we know
 Token NUMBER/'1' ... It's a token we know
 Token NEWLINE/'' ... It's a token we know
 Token NEWLINE/'' ... It's a token we know
 Token ENDMARKER/'' ... It's a token we know
The fix is trivial. Patch attached.
msg149801 - (view) Author: Martin v. Löwis (loewis) * (Python committer) Date: 2011年12月18日 19:54
Is there a reason not to renumber token.h?
msg149809 - (view) Author: Meador Inge (meador.inge) * (Python committer) Date: 2011年12月19日 00:53
> Is there a reason not to renumber token.h?
I thought about that, but at the time I wasn't sure whether or not that
would break anything. I went with the current patch because it is lower
risk.
On the other hand, proper clients of token.h should only be using the macros and should have no knowledge of the numeric codes. If they do use the numeric codes directly somehow, then that is their issue. So, I guess it is OK to renumber token.h.
